Apple's AirPods get a $10 tether (so maybe you won't lose them)

But then what's the point?

Apple's incoming AirPods are a technical marvel, cramming a load of tech into the same teeny tiny earbud cases that have been packaged with iPhones for years. While we wait to test a pair out for ourselves, accessory makers have wasted no time in correcting possible design faults in Apple's new headphones. Spigen has taken it upon itself to announce a ten-dollar tangle-free strap to keep the 'phones together -- and, well, un-wireless them.

The AirPods Strap is already listed on Amazon and -- patent pending -- is set to ship October 17th, when you'll maybe already fear misplacing one half of the $150 pair. It is very much simply a glorified tether: there's no electronics or wiring inside, but it really does defeat the purpose of the darn things. Almost like a headphone converter.
